Although Kevin Kane and Tom Hooper did put out a fine record with 2000's "Field Trip" and both have had great solo records in between, it's indeed exciting to finally have an album from the original Grapes lineup (Kevin Kane, Tom Hooper, Chris Hooper).
 
As Bruce used to say: "extremely highly recommended!"
